Europe’s e-health opportunity

  • 25 February 2009

In a video address opening of the e-Health 2009 ministerial conference in Prague, Viviane Reding , European Commissioner for Information and Society, sets out the challenge and opportunities of e-health.

In her video address Commissioner Reding outlines what Europe has already done to promote e-health research and development, and why expanding e-health investment is an essential part of Europe’s economic recovery programme.
